Remanded (sent back)
The Board remanded the claim for service connection of diabetes mellitus type II as secondary to insomnia because the VA medical exam did not adequately address potential aggravation.
The deciding factor: The VA medical exam was inadequate because it failed to address whether the Veteran's diabetes could have been aggravated by his service-connected insomnia.
